Innovative
adjective
Characterized by the creation of new ideas or things
Ai Feedback
The word "innovative" is correct and can be used in written English.
You can use it when talking about a person, idea, or object that introduces something new or different. For example: "The company has taken an innovative approach to marketing this product."
